Gz0707 4th Gear August 2, 2019 Share August 2, 2019 (edited) Just installed the VEP and tried this week - out of 4 tolls, 3 worked, but the last one could not be detected, so I went back to using TNG card. I have also linked the VEP RFID to credit card for auto top up too. Whenever you go thru a toll, the app is instantly updated. There are also some rebates on-going. The app also shows u the last 5 transactions for the TNG card too. Edited August 2, 2019 by Gz0707 4 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
